The Island's Commonwealth Games Association has already been forced to start fundraising for next year's event to cover spiraling costs.
It's thought the squad going to Glasgow will be the strongest ever assembled from the Isle of Man, with the cycling team already tipped for gold.
However, this is coming at a six-figure cost and the association has to find all the funding itself.
This year's series of charity events begins on St Patrick's Day next month with the Manx Superstars challenge.
